New to forum, considering the sleeve
woo woo replied to Sbagdan's topic in PRE-Operation Weight Loss Surgery Q&A
Just wanted to say good for you on making your appointment. It takes guts to make that first step! Regarding your medications, your surgeon can obvi speak more specifically on this, but there is a good chance that you will reduce and/or eliminate the need for many of your medications. I know for sure that is true for many people with regards to BP and diabetes meds at the very least. There is also a good chance at resolving your sleep apnea as well (if it is caused by the extra weight). Please keep us posted and let us know how your consult goes! -

Anyone like me? 5'5" 180lbs bmi 30?
woo woo replied to 50lbstogo's topic in PRE-Operation Weight Loss Surgery Q&A
Well at 35 I was around your size (a little taller). A year later I was over 200. Now 4 years after that I'm still over 200 and getting the sleeve. To answer your question, I wish I'd done it sooner but I'm not 100% sure that I wish I'd done it at 180 if that makes any sense at all. I feel like I could have lost the weight at 180 but I waited too long until I was over 200 and couldn't come back from there, too far along I guess. Currently bmi 35. -
